2011 SAAG National Juried Show
October 15th - November 12th
212 Applicants from 33 states and over 600 works of art submitted. Selected 109 artists from 27 states. Exhibit showcases 146 works of art in the Richard Low Evans Gallery at The Art Center in Blue Ridge, GA.

Judge: William Undersood Eiland
Director of the Georgia Museum of Art
A native of Sprott, Ala., William Underwood Eiland is the director of the Georgia Museum of Art. He took a B.A. (summa cum laude) from Birmingham-Southern College and an M.A. and Ph.D. from the University of Virginia. A Woodrow Wilson Fellow, Eiland has been the recipient of several fellowships, including the Danforth Teaching Fellowship at the University of Virginia, a Museum Professionals Grant from the National Endowment for the Arts and a Research Fellowship from the University of Georgia Center for Humanities and Arts. He has also edited and contributed to more than 50 publications, including Art Papers, Georgia Journal, US Art, Ceramics Monthly, Southern Antiques and English Literature in Transition and has been general editor of seven catalogues at the Georgia Museum of Art. Notably, Eiland authored The Truth in Things: The Life and Career of Lamar Dodd, published by the University of Georgia Press.
He serves on the boards of the American Association of Museums, the Southeastern Museums Conference andthe Georgia Association of Museums and Galleries; is a trustee of the Association of Art Museum Directors; and chairman of the Arts and Artifacts Indemnity Advisory Panel for the National Endowment for the Arts. Eiland earned the Lifetime Achievement Award from the Georgia Association of Museums and Galleries in 2007.
He was named 2000 Museum Professional of the Year by the Georgia Association of Museums and Galleries and 1999 Outstanding Museum Professional by the Southeast College Art Conference. He also served as the vice chairman of the American Association of Museums in 2004-2005.

Dates for the 2012 Show are October 20-November 9, 2012. Entry deadline is August 1, 2012. (Selected art should be delivered October 6, 2012 and art pickup is November 10, 2012)
$5,000 in prize money will be awarded.
Artists who are residents of the United States are eligible to participate in this juried exhibition of two-dimensional and three-dimensional artworks.
The Southern Appalachian Artist Guild’s National Juried Show takes place in Blue Ridge, Georgia, in the historic Richard Low Evans Courtroom Gallery at The Blue Ridge Mountains Arts Association. The show coincides with the peak of autumn foliage in the Southern Appalachian Mountains of North Georgia.
